The owners of a 2019 Nissan Altima contacted the Elizabeth Police Department to report his vehicle stolen from the driveway of his residence in the City of Elizabeth. The keys were in the vehicle when stolen.  The Elizabeth Police Department verified the theft and entered the vehicle information into the state and federal crime computers, which automatically activated the LoJack® System concealed in the 2019 Nissan Altima.     

A short while later, officers from the Newark Police Department picked up the silent LoJack signal coming from the stolen Nissan with the LoJack Police Tracking Computers (PTC) installed in their patrol vehicles.  Following the directional and audible cues from the PTC, the officers tracked the vehicle to Center Ave. in the City of Newark, where the vehicle was located parked and unoccupied on the street. The vehicle was recovered undamaged.

The LoJack® System was installed in the 2019 Nissan Altima in November 2019 at Route 1Nissan in New Jersey.
